Multi-Factor Authentication Extended to Anderson

To improve safeguards that protect sensitive financial data from cyber threats, multi-factor authentication (MFA), also known as two-factor authentication, has recently been added to the Bursar Account Suite (TouchNet) and Loboweb. Anderson is part of a pilot project to extend MFA to additional UNM IT services.

On Tuesday, Feb. 23, Anderson student, faculty and staff accounts will be enabled with UNM’s MFA service for LoboMail, Outlook, Teams and more. New Mexico Rainforest Webinar:
Business Strategy Matrices
by Phil Wilton

Monday, February 22
2-3 p.m.

Phil Wilton will discuss three business strategy matrices: SWOT, the Resource Based View of Strategy and Five Forces, with Q&A following.

Wilton brings significant experience as an executive in national and multi-national companies in both the UK and the USA. He has worked in all regions across the globe, with different companies and cultures., encountering many business pivots, mergers and acquisitions and disruption and inflection points that impacted businesses.

NASBITE International
Certified Global Business Professional Credential

Anderson recently partnered with the North American Business and International Trade Educators (NASBITE) International and their Certified Global Business Professional credential. This certificate is recognized across more than 100 top schools across the country and gives students opportunities to attend conferences and participate in global competitions focused on global business issues.

CREW New Mexico Scholarship Opportunity

Application Deadline:
Thursday, April 15


The CREW Network Foundation scholarship program supports future female leaders as they pursue university-level education that will lead to careers in commercial real estate. CREW Network Foundation will award $5,000 academic scholarships to 25 young women in 2021.
